The Eurasian Youth Assembly holds Online Working meetings on 2021 Projects

25/02/2021 21:00

On February 25, the Eurasian Youth Assembly held a an online working meeting of its active and members of the Coordination Council with representatives of partner Universities and students wishing to join the Assembly team was held in format.

The meeting summed up the implementation of the projects “EYA Lecture Hall” and DISCOVER EURASIA, outlined plans for further development. In addition, EYA's participation in the events of the Eurasian Peoples' Assembly were discussed, in particular, in the expert round table “Greater Eurasia – Africa” and the Online Marathon “Eurasian Languages Symphony” dedicated to the UNESCO International Mother Language Day.

Strengthening of partnerships was the main topic of the discussion, first of all, partnerships with the Moscow Economic Institute, the Moscow International Institute of Informatics, Management, Economics and Law, Ryazan State University, the Russian Union of Journalists and the Indian International Fund for Improving Education and Skills of Youth.
